Commercial Ranges – Gas or Electric?

Something to know concerning commercial ranges is they are available in electric or gas models. Both types have their own benefits and disadvantages.

Gas appliances are much more powerful, and better suited towards large scale commercial operations. The appliances heat up quickly and are generally a lot more durable. For cooking, gas ovens are the preferred type for chefs. Gas fryers and gas ovens are typically in commercial kitchens as they offer more power. Overall, this type of commercial range has fewer components and can be easier to maintain and require less commercial repair.

That said, some of the commercial electric appliances offer benefits too. For example, electric stoves offer better baking features – such as convection. Electric commercial appliances are typically much simpler and safer to cook with, as well as cost-effective. Most of the smaller appliances, such as toasters, are exclusively electric.

Commercial Exhaust Hoods

Exhaust hoods are necessary addition to any commercial kitchen. They are needed for safe use of the kitchen, as well as keeping in code with health regulations.

Exhaust hoods serve a few different purposes. They can be used to remove smoke, steam, and hot air from a commercial kitchen during cooking. They can also be used to eliminate grease and food particles.

No commercial kitchen can function with no working ventilation system. There are many different types of exhaust hoods for purchase for your specific kitchen and requirements.

Commercial Walk-In Freezers

A walk-in freezer is not an appliance that you would expect to see in a domestic kitchen! But, they’re very common in restaurants. These massive freezers are mandatory for any food service operating at a high volume. Commercial kitchens have to have a lot of space to keep frozen food and that is why a walk-in is needed.

These commercial freezers are also a must-have for commercial kitchens that have to freeze large containers or boxes that can’t fit inside of a residential freezer. You can get many different sized walk-in freezers. They are custom-made to the amount of space you have.

Commercial Fryers

From chicken wings to french fries, a deep fryer can cook a lot of tasty food for a restaurant. Some foods just cannot be cooked unless there’s a commercial fryer. These are appliances that will soon become excellent assets for cooking meals and appetizers.

You can choose between gas or electric fryers. Electric fryers do take a while longer to heat up, but they recover a lot quicker between frying cycles. They’re also simpler to use. Gas fryers can reach higher temperatures, and they also heat up faster.

Beyond electric or gas, you can buy stand-up fryers or countertop fryers. These can come in all types of different sizes and volumes, depending on your requirements.

Commercial Grills

The grill is typically the focus of a kitchen. This is where most of the hot dishes are cooked, and it is crucial that your grill performs to your needs. Grills are available in a variety of shapes and models, and it’s important to choose the one that is best suited for what you’re cooking.

You can get gas or electric grills. Gas grills provide higher and faster heat. They also grill more evenly. Electric grills are typically less expensive and may have more features. However, electric grills heat slower and can be difficult to maintain.

Commercial Steam Cooking Equipment

Steam cooking is a great method that can be used for many types of foods. This type of cooking is energy-efficient and cost-effective. Commercial steamers are available in countertop, floor, or microwave models. You can also purchase steam kettles, combi ovens, steam generators and portion steamers.

Steam cooking is very healthy, not to mention fast and efficient. It also provides a great way of keeping prepared food warm and not drying out.

Commercial Toasters

Commercial toasters are necessary for kitchens and restaurants that provide breakfast. Toasters can vary widely, depending on what their specific use is. You can purchase flat press toasters (great for sandwiches), commercial pop-up toasters, roller toasters, bun-grilling toasters and more. Even waffle irons fall under this category.

For commercial kitchens that cook a lot of breakfast, quick and efficient commercial toasters are essential.

Commercial Specialty Cooking Equipment

Some unique food items cannot be cooked with regular appliances – especially if you require them cooked at a high quantity. This is when specialized cooking equipment comes in.

Specialty equipment serves a single unique function. If you’re planning on preparing something very specific, you may want the exact tool for the job. This equipment could include pasta cookers, crepe makers, waffle cone makers, sous vide immersion circulators and more.
